The injections that they get are in the lower back, deep into the muscle and they hurt terribly. Did your vet put him on prednisone or Doxycycline? I also have given pups pain meds for the first couple of days. You might want to ask your vet about a pain med if he is uncomfortable. My vet gives Bupranex.

Please do keep him quiet! That is ultra important during HW treatment. Crate rest is best....if I get a pup that stresses in a crate, I keep them tethered to me whenever I am sitting for a period of time so that they can be out of the crate. Usually most of them are ok in a crate.
